CVE-2023-28774: WordPress Review Stream Plugin <= 1.6.5 is vulnerable to Cross Site Scripting (XSS)

Auth. (admin+) Stored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) vulnerability in Grade Us, Inc. Review Stream plugin <= 1.6.5 versions.

Plain-English summary

CVE-2023-28774 affects the WordPress Review Stream plugin through version 1.6.5. An authenticated administrator-level user could store malicious script content that runs when another user views it. This is a medium-risk issue because exploitation requires high privileges and user interaction, but successful abuse can still affect confidentiality, integrity, and availability in the browser context.

Executive priority

Treat this as a moderate WordPress plugin risk. It does not indicate unauthenticated compromise or known active exploitation, but vulnerable plugin deployments should be found and remediated during the next scheduled security maintenance window, sooner for sites with many administrators.

Technical view

The issue is a stored cross-site scripting flaw, CWE-79, in Grade Us Review Stream for WordPress <= 1.6.5. CVSS 3.1 is 5.9 with network access, low complexity, high privileges required, user interaction required, changed scope, and low confidentiality, integrity, and availability impact. The supplied sources do not identify the vulnerable parameter or fixed version.

Likely exposure

Exposure is limited to WordPress sites with the Review Stream plugin installed at version 1.6.5 or earlier. Risk is highest where multiple administrator-level accounts exist, admin accounts are weakly governed, or plugin pages are accessible to untrusted site managers.

Exploitation context

The source bundle does not show active exploitation, and the CVE is not marked as CISA KEV. Abuse requires an authenticated admin-level user and a victim viewing stored content, so this is more likely in compromised-admin or insider-risk scenarios than unauthenticated mass exploitation.

Mitigation direction

  • Inventory WordPress sites for the Review Stream plugin and installed version.
  • Check vendor or Patchstack guidance for a fixed version or official remediation.
  • Update the plugin if a fixed release is available from trusted sources.
  • Disable or remove the plugin where it is unused or cannot be remediated.
  • Restrict administrator-level access and review accounts with plugin management privileges.

Validation and detection

  • Confirm whether Review Stream is installed on each WordPress instance.
  • Verify whether any installed version is 1.6.5 or earlier.
  • Review administrator accounts for unnecessary or stale privileged access.
  • Check vendor and Patchstack records for current remediation guidance.
  • Look for unexpected plugin content changes without testing exploit payloads.
